Here are all our Fryers

1 Robert Fryer1
Birth:   c1861, Co. Antrim, Ireland2
Residence:   1912, 8 Tenth St, Belfast3
Occupation:   Flax weaver1

Spouse:   Sarah Lyness2,4
Birth:   1868, Co. Antrim, Ireland2
Marriage:   10 Jul 1887, Lambeg Church Of Ireland, Lisburn2,4

Children:   Robert (1889-), John (1892-), James Edward (1894-), Albert (1896-), Gertrude (1898-), Kathleen (1902-), Victor (1904-), William Mc..... (1907-), Thomas (1908-)

1.1 Robert Fryer
Birth:   1889, Belfast?, Antrim1,2
Residence:   1910, 8 Tenth Street, Belfast1
Residence:   1911,  28 Lime Street (Court Ward, Antrim)
Occupation:   Butcher2

Spouse:   Mary ‘Minnie’ Cassells1
Birth:   18 Aug 1891, Tannaghmore North, Co. Armagh5
Father:   William [Billie] Cassells  (1852-1947)
Mother:   Elizabeth McBride (1857-1912)
Marriage:   18 Dec 1910, Saint Lukes Lower Falls Church of Ireland4

Children:   Muriel (1910-), Elizabeth (1915-), Myrtle (1915-), Ralph (1915-), Edward (1915-), Kenneth (1915-)

1.2 John Fryer
Birth:   1892, Co. Antrim, Ireland2

1.3 James Edward Fryer2
Birth:   1894, Co. Antrim, Ireland2

1.4 Albert Fryer
Birth:   1896, Co. Antrim, Ireland

1.5 Gertrude Fryer2
Birth:   1898, Co. Antrim, Ireland

1.6 Kathleen Fryer
Birth:   1902, Co. Antrim, Ireland

1.7 Victor Fryer
Birth:   1904, Belfast

1.8 William Mc..... Fryer2
Birth:   1907, Belfast

1.9 Thomas Fryer
Birth:   1908, Belfast


Sources
1. “Wedding Cert.”
2. “1911 census.”
3. Ulster Covenant 1912
4. Emerald Ancestors
5. “Birth cert.”
